Check Digit Verification of cas no

The CAS Registry Mumber 79756-70-0 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 7,9,7,5 and 6 respectively; the second part has 2 digits, 7 and 0 respectively.
Calculate Digit Verification of CAS Registry Number 79756-70:
(7*7)+(6*9)+(5*7)+(4*5)+(3*6)+(2*7)+(1*0)=190
190 % 10 = 0
So 79756-70-0 is a valid CAS Registry Number.

Oxidative Coupling of Quinones and Aromatic Compounds by Palladium(II) Acetate

Itahara, Toshio

, p. 5546 - 5550 (2007/10/02)

The oxidation of 1,4-benzoquinone, 2-phenyl-1,4-benzoquinone, 1,4-naphthoquinone, and 1,2-naphthoquinone by palladium(II) acetate in acetic acid containing arenes gave the corresponding aryl-sustituted quinones.Treatment of 1,4-naphthoquinone with aromatic heterocycles such as furfural, 2-acetylfuran, methyl 2-furoate, 2-acetylthiophene, 1-(phenylsulfonyl)pyrrole, 1-(phenylsulfonyl)indole, 4-pyrone, and 1-methyl-2-pyridone in the presence of palladium acetate gave the corresponding 2-heteroaryl-substituted 1,4-naphthoquinones.
